A traditional Jewish spread made from chopped liver, onions, and eggs.
A spread is a food item designed to be applied onto other foods, typically using a knife. It is commonly spread onto products like bread or crackers. The primary function of a spread is to enhance the flavor or texture of the food it accompanies, which might otherwise be considered bland. Examples of spreads include butter and various soft cheeses.
